On this fiery episode of Hot & Bothered with Melyssa Ford, Melyssa flips the script and interviews the legendary Voice of New York—Angie Martinez. Widely regarded as one of the most influential figures in hip-hop media, Angie steps into the spotlight for an intimate, revealing conversation unlike any she’s had before.Together, Angie and Melyssa carve out their personal “Women in Media Mount Rushmore,” unpack the legacy of Angie’s groundbreaking memoir My Voice, and celebrate the deep bond she shares with her fans and the culture. Angie opens up about the car accident that changed her life, the physical and emotional recovery that followed, and how she found unexpected peace—and power—on the golf course.The conversation turns nostalgic as Angie reflects on her 25+ years in radio, from manually editing shows to mastering the art of protecting artists while still delivering powerful interviews. She shares her behind-the-scenes perspective on navigating high-stakes moments—like the East Coast/West Coast beef—and how those lessons shaped her approach to storytelling and responsibility in media.As the episode winds down, Angie offers a glimpse into her evolving career, future goals, and exciting projects on the horizon.
